Transaction 2294612fb61fdd5c622e26eed0e9d20ba7a394fdd0f1af3ec0669c3eb7df63c6
1 Input
1 Output
-
2294612fb61fdd5c622e26eed0e9d20ba7a394fdd0f1af3ec0669c3eb7df63c6:0
- value
- 366977147
- script pubkey
- OP_0 OP_PUSHBYTES_20 afb12d0bedbccbfbebb67eb7ff18980a873a0085
- address
- bc1q47cj6zldhn9lh6ak06ml7xycp2rn5qy9kqd4vm